位置:首页 > 题库频道 > 其它分类 > 计算机其它 > 专业技术初级资格程序员基础知识2007年下半年程序员上午试卷

● 对于长度为11的顺序存储的有序表,若采用折半查找(向下取整),则找到第5个元素需要与表中的 (39) 个元素进行比较操作(包括与第5个元素的比较)。

发布时间:2024-07-09

A.5

B.4

C.3

D.2

试卷相关题目

  • 1● 若一个栈以向量V[1..n]存储,且空栈的栈顶指针top为n+1,则将元素x入栈的正确操作是 (37) 。

    A.top = top+1; V[top] = x;

    B.V[top] = x; top = top+1;

    C.top = top-1; V[top] = x;

    D.V[top] = x; top = top-1;

    开始考试点击查看答案
  • 2● n个元素依次全部进入栈后,再陆续出栈并经过一个队列输出。那么, (36) 。

    A.元素的出队次序与进栈次序相同

    B.元素的出队次序与进栈次序相反

    C.元素的进栈次序与进队次序相同

    D.元素的出栈次序与出队次序相反

    开始考试点击查看答案
  • 3●  在统一建模语言(Unified Modeling Language,UML)中,描述本系统与外部系统及用户之间交互的图是 (34) ;按时间顺序描述对象间交互的图是 (35)  。

    A.用例图

    B.类图

    C.对象图

    D.状态图

    开始考试点击查看答案
  • 4●  若程序中使用的变量未设置初始值,则 (33) 。

    A.编译时一定出错

    B.运行时一定会出错

    C.链接时一定出错

    D.运行结果可能出错

    开始考试点击查看答案
  • 5● 函数调用采用“ (32) ”方式时,系统将实参的地址传递给形式参数。

    A.传值调用

    B.引用调用

    C.宏调用

    D.内部调用

    开始考试点击查看答案
  • 6● 与单向链表相比,双向链表 (40) 。

    A.需要较少的存储空间

    B.遍历元素需要的时间较短

    C.较易于访问相邻结点

    D.较易于插入和删除元素

    开始考试点击查看答案
  • 7● 如果待排序序列中两个元素具有相同的值,在排序前后它们的相互位置发生颠倒,则称该排序算法是不稳定的。 (41) 是稳定的排序方法,因为这种方法在比较相邻元素时,值相同的元素并不进行交换。

    A.冒泡排序

    B.希尔排序

    C.快速排序

    D.简单选择排序

    开始考试点击查看答案
  • 8● 关于对象和类的叙述,正确的是 (44) 。

    A.如果两个对象的所有成员变量的值相同,则这两个对象是同一对象

    B.编写代码时,不允许使用匿名类

    C.不同的对象一定属于不同的类

    D.每个对象都有惟一标识,以彼此区分

    开始考试点击查看答案
  • 9●  (45) 关系描述了某对象由其他对象组成。

    A.依赖

    B.一般化

    C.聚合

    D.具体化

    开始考试点击查看答案
  • 10● 关于对象封装的叙述,正确的是 (46) 。

    A.每个程序模块中都封装了若干个对象

    B.封装可实现信息隐藏

    C.封装使对象的状态不能改变

    D.封装是把对象放在同一个集合中

    开始考试点击查看答案
返回顶部